Selecting Nx Units; Free-Run Refreshing - Omron NX-ID User Manual

Machine automation controller nx-series digital i/o units
Table of Contents

Advertisement

5 I/O Refreshing
*1. Two types of time stamp refreshing are available: one is input refreshing with input changed time and the other
is output refreshing with specified time stamp.
*2. The EtherCAT Slave Terminal operates in DC Mode.
*3. The EtherCAT Slave Terminal operates in Free-Run Mode.
*4. Refer to P. 5-26 and P. 5-32 for information on the operation when the DC is set to Disabled (FreeRun).
5-2-3

Selecting NX Units

The I/O refreshing methods that you can use depend on the model of the NX Unit. After you decide on
which I/O refreshing method to use, select the NX Units.
5-2-4

Free-Run Refreshing

With this I/O refreshing method, the refresh cycle of the NX bus and I/O refresh cycles of the NX Units
are asynchronous.
Digital I/O Units read inputs or refresh outputs at the time of I/O refreshing.
This method is used when it is not necessary to be aware of factors such as the I/O timing jitter and the
concurrency of the timing to read inputs and refresh outputs between the NX Units.
Description of Operation
CPU Unit Operation
The following describes the operation of Free-Run refreshing between the NX-series NX1P2 CPU
Unit and the NX Units.
• The CPU Unit performs I/O refreshing for NX Units. (Refer to (a) in the figure below.)
• The NX Units read inputs or refresh outputs at the time of I/O refreshing. (Refer to (b) in the figure
below.)
• The CPU Unit can read the most recent input value at the time of I/O refreshing and the NX Units
can control the most recent output value at the time of I/O refreshing. However, timing to read
inputs or to refresh outputs for each NX Unit does not occur at the same time. (Refer to (c) in the
figure below.)
• The interval of I/O refreshing varies with the processing conditions of the CPU Unit. Therefore, the
interval of the timing to read inputs or to refresh outputs for NX Unit is not always the same. (Refer
to (d) in the figure below.)
• In order to read input values correctly, you must set the inputs before the total of the ON/OFF
response time and the input filter time from the timing to read inputs for each NX Unit.
• The ON/OFF response time is needed from the timing to refresh outputs until setting the output
status of external terminals on the NX Units.
5 - 8
NX-series Digital I/O Unit User's Manual (W521)

Advertisement

Table of Contents
loading

Table of Contents